White corundum 36# and 30# for sandblasting railway tracks

White corundum 36# and 30# for sandblasting railway tracks
White corundum 36# and 30#​ are high-purity, high-hardness abrasive grains used for surface preparation​ of railway tracks. They are ideal for removing rust, mill scale, and contaminants while creating a perfect surface profile for subsequent processes like welding or applying anti-corrosion coatings.

1. Keyword Explanation

White Corundum (Aluminum Oxide)

  • Composition:​ A synthetic abrasive made from fused high-purity aluminum oxide. It is distinct from brown corundum due to its higher purity.
  • Key Properties:
    • High Hardness (9.0 on the Mohs scale):​ Second only to diamond and silicon carbide, providing excellent cutting ability.
    • High Purity & Sharpness:​ Results in clean, low-contamination blasting, which is critical for welding integrity.
    • Good Toughness:​ Resists fracturing upon impact, allowing for potential reuse with a recycling system.
    • Chemically Inert:​ Does not react with the steel surface.

Grit Size: 30# and 36#

This refers to the particle size according to international standards (like FEPA). The “#” symbol indicates a coarse grit.
  • 30#:​ A coarser​ grit. It removes heavy rust and thick mill scale very quickly and creates a deeper surface profile (anchor pattern).
  • 36#:​ A medium-coarse​ grit. This is arguably the most common and balanced choice​ for rail blasting. It offers a great balance between fast cleaning speed, controlled surface profile, and efficient media usage.

Sandblasting (Abrasive Blasting)

In rail maintenance, this is a surface preparation​ process where abrasive particles are propelled at high velocity onto the rail surface to:
  • Clean:​ Remove all rust, old paint, oil, and mill scale.
  • Profile (Anchor Pattern):​ Create a microscopically rough surface that dramatically increases the adhesion of coatings or the quality of welds.
  • Peen:​ Impart beneficial compressive stresses on the surface.
